About the Role

JOB SUMMARY:

Under general direction of the Senior Vice President-Chief Legal & Ethics Officer (SVP-CLEO), the counsel for

environmental law & regulatory compliance provides strategic and tactical oversight, develops and implements

legal and business strategies consistent with the strategic plan, long-range water resource plans, and plans for

the development and construction of water supplies facilities for the System, in conformance with local, state

and federal law, court decisions, and administrative rules and regulations. Counsel for environmental law &

regulatory compliance focuses on unique and challenging issues related to environmental compliance and

networks with state and federal regulators.


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:

• Provides legal counsel and advice to the SVP-CLEO, SAWS’ Board of Trustees, President/CEO, Executive

Management, and staff within related specialty.


• Maintains current knowledge and understanding of regulatory and policy developments, advises the SVP-

CLEO of potential impacts and develops compliance strategies.


• Represents the organization in enforcement actions, including appearing before relevant agencies.


• Provides management and supervision to in-house counsel and retains and manages outside counsel.


• Performs, plans, and assigns the legal services of the System related to the specialties, which may include

drafting of ordinances, resolutions, contracts, deeds, leases and other legal documents, and supervises

litigation as necessary.


• Prepares legal opinions for the System and/or its Board of Trustees; attends various governing board

meetings to advise on legal issues and questions.


• Plans and evaluates performance of assigned staff and legal consultants; establishes performance

requirements and personal development targets; regularly monitors performance and provides coaching

for performance improvement and development; takes disciplinary action to address performance

deficiencies in accordance with the System’s personnel policies.


• Advises the SVP-CLEO on the status of litigation on a regular basis and provides the SVP-CLEO with the

various legal strategies for management of that litigation. Implements the decisions of the SVP-CLEO,

President/CEO and the Board of Trustees regarding litigation.


• Provides legal representation, advice, and opinions in managing and resolving disputes that may lead to

litigation.


• Provides direct legal support to the System’s legislative affairs team.


• Attends Board of Trustee meetings and counsels and advises the Board regarding environmental and

compliance related legal matters affecting the System.


• Evaluates and promotes the use of new technology to enhance quality and efficiency of services provided.

• Forecasts, allocates, and monitors the human, physical and financial resources for the Group.


• Leads, selects, and develops, a team of professionals charged with executing business strategy and

maintaining operational integrity.
